Dutch 3: The Finale by Dutch

Dutch: The Finale by Dutch is the third installment in the life of “Dutch” crime boss. Now while I have never read the first two parts, I am going to say that this is a stand alone book, but I will be picking up the other two parts to fill in the blanks.

Dutch is a young man who has made his name in the drug game and with a strong team backing him how can he lose? The characters in this book are grimy, ruthless, and crazy, and will stop at nothing to get what they want. Dutch has been running his business while in hiding in an undisclosed location; he wants to put his team back together again. He has a number of connections and he is stronger and more powerful than ever. Can he finally come out of hiding? Will this be his last run? Or can he make the cartels come together and work in harmony to drop this new lethal drug he is trying to put on the market?

When an FBI agent infiltrates their team, and tries to win their trust, all bets are off. Goldilocks is the epitome of deceit; she has wormed her way into the arms of Angel, Dutchs’ right hand man and wiggled her way into finding out where the hideout spot is where Dutch has been hiding for so long. Will the guys find out who the snake is before it is too late or will all of Dutch’s hard work go up in smoke? In this line of business you make a lot of enemies, can Dutch take this multi-million dollar plan to the limit before his time runs out? Only time will tell.

This book is filled with twists and turns that you will not believe. This was a well-written story that left me wanting more, I cannot believe the way the story ended which led me to run to the bookstore and grab the previous two books. Dutch is great storyteller and I look forward to reading more from him. I recommend this book to all street literature lovers. The ending will blow you away!
